The militia of Kharkov is investigating the attack on the Consulate General of the Russian Federation
Proceedings on the fact of attack eleven June at the Consulate General of Russia in Kharkiv is Conducted in accordance with paragraph " hooliganism ", said on Wednesday on a press-conferences the chief of a municipal government of militia Andrey Krishchenko.

"Opened criminal proceedings according to section 206 of the Criminal code (hooliganism). The case is under investigation. Received no damage. There is only the message of the Russian side with the requirement to understand ", - quotes the message Krishchenko local history".

The head of the Kharkiv Department of the Ministry of internal Affairs said that the participants of the events known to the police." However, in order to evaluate the crime, the desired composition (crime - ed.) and hooligan motive. Currently we are studying. If their actions were rowdy underlying causes, we will give them a rating, " said Krishchenko.

first it was claimed that the activists of the Kharkiv organization "gromadska VARTA" threw eggs and green paint, the building of the Russian Consulate in Kharkiv. In the Russian Embassy said that the aggressive protesters blocked the building of the Consulate General of Russia in Kharkiv, there were approximately 100 people. The Russian side insists on a speedy completion of the investigation of the attack on the Russian diplomatic mission.

a year Earlier, on June 16, 2014, several hundred active participants of "euromaidan" picketed the Russian Consulate in Odessa, demanding to remove the Russian flag. Most of the protesters were holding flags of Ukraine and extremist Association of Ukrainian nationalists " Right sector ". They brought to the building of funeral wreaths, as well as car tires. The place was built a cordon of policemen. Between protesters and security forces there was a fight. At least 1 citizen suffered. Later, law enforcement officers managed to detain the 4 participants.
